>  In an email from Brad Knowles, he stated: If they are not subscribers, "then
>  they need to be on the whitelist."  But I cannot find a whitelist anywhere.

Go to the web mail admin interface for your list.  Go to the "Privacy 
options..." sub-page, then to "Sender filters".

The second field on the page should be labeled 
"accept_these_nonmembers" with a description of "List of non-member 
addresses whose postings should be automatically accepted."  That's 
your whitelist.
